I've asked 2 nissan dealers on what oil they use on the xtrail:
1) Nissan Gallery- Caltex 15w40 diesel oil
2) Nissan Commonw- Valvoline turbo formula 15w40 API SJ/CF
Both claim these were supplied by Nissan Phil.
Guess the common factor is 15w40, mineral oil for either gas or diesel.
I've supplied Citgo 15w40 diesel oil and Conoco 10w40 Api SL, both were ok for warranty purposes. Manual actually prefers 10w30 but they don't use it.
